i would love to go to one of the water parks when im down at the world for my solo trip. i would be going the first day i get down there. this may be my only chance because when my family goes to the world they dont ever want to go to the water parks. so my question is has anyone gone alone before? Im worried that i may lose my room key or something like that. do they have lockers that the key could easly be put around my neck so it doesnt get lost? or should i just skip the water park and go to dtd?
 
The locker key, if I remenber correctly, goes on a band around your wrist. It is worth doing, but always more fun with another person, especially on the lazy river raft floats. In the wave pool, however, you are on your own. The slides, too. What the heck. Go for it!
 
You actually have a few options.

The safest, of course, is to rent a locker since the key is on a band on your wrist. However, be sure to make note of your locker number in case you lose your key as it is possible for the lockers to be opened by a manager. (There has to be a procedure to open lockers where people don't turn in their keys at the end of the day and leave an empty locker locked so there can be future availabilty.)

You can bring with you, or purchase at the park, a waterproof plastic box about the size of a cigarette pack which is designed to hold money and cards and other small items (such as a watch or even small cell phone).

You can take a chance, fairly safe, in having a beach towel and keeping something such as your room key under it. Since the key does not actually have your room number on it (and the resort itself is in a code) it would be useless if someone takes it. You could get in your room, and a replacement issued, by working with Security if it became missing.

I just visited Blizzard Beach solo last week and I had a blast! Lockers are available, and probably a good idea, but I decided to tempt fate and just left all of my things indise my beach bag underneath my chair. My things were untouched and I had a wondeful day. Enjoy!
